Summary
Bitmine Immersion Technologies (BMNR) acquired 101,627 Ethereum (ETH) tokens in its largest weekly purchase of 2026, bringing total ETH holdings to 4.976 million tokens. The company's combined cryptocurrency and cash position reached $12.9 billion as of the April 20 announcement. The acquisition was highlighted alongside commentary from analyst Tom Lee regarding a potential crypto winter outlook, though the detailed connection between the institutional purchase and the bearish forecast was not fully elaborated in the available excerpt. The announcement demonstrates ongoing institutional accumulation of Ethereum despite concurrent market predictions of a potential downturn period.
